1. To fix the leaks from around the door, I replaced the upper and lower door seals. These were purchased in a separate transcation, so they are not the parts shown here. The upper door seal worked as intended, but the lower seal would not stay in place on the lower edge of the door during a wash. Therefore I cleaned the grease and detergent off the old seal, and installed using silicone sealer/adhesive. Assessed the situation and determined that the metal strike was broken. The unit did not work and no power due to this. Looked up the part with the model number and installed in less than 10 minutes. Unit worked immediately. The two screws require a star wrench or small nut driver for removal. Very easy! Read more

Note: If no display on the control panel, check the thermal fuse on board first before ordering this part.
